Both interval_val and sliding_value are time durations which have 3 forms of representation.
|
||||
- INTERVAL(1s, 500a) SLIDING(1s), the unit char should be any one of a (millisecond), b (nanosecond), d (day), h (hour), m (minute), n (month), s (second), u (microsecond), w (week), y (year).
|
||||
- INTERVAL(1000, 500) SLIDING(1000), the unit will the same as the queried database, if there are more than one databases, higher precision will be used.
|
||||
- INTERVAL('1s', '500a') SLIDING('1s'), unit must be specified, no spaces allowed.
